NRCC Criticized for Comments on Hispanic Congressman

News summary

The National Republican Congressional Committee (NRCC) faced strong criticism after labeling Representative Adriano Espaillat, a naturalized U.S. citizen and chair of the Congressional Hispanic Caucus, as an 'illegal immigrant' on social media. This attack followed Espaillat's Spanish-language response to President Trump's congressional address, where he criticized Trump’s immigration policies. The comment sparked backlash from Democrats, including House Minority Leader Hakeem Jeffries, who condemned the statement as 'disgusting,' and New York Governor Kathy Hochul, who called it 'vile, ignorant, and racist.' Espaillat, originally from the Dominican Republic, became a U.S. citizen more than 40 years ago after his family initially overstayed their visas but soon obtained green cards. The NRCC defended their post, arguing that Democrats focus more on words than on border security issues. This incident highlights ongoing tensions and accusations of racism within U.S. political discourse, particularly concerning immigration policy.
